A beautiful spot, behind the sports hall and between a football field and a tennis court. There was supposed to be some noise from the trains, but we weren't bothered by them because we heard about it later. A few villages further on, there was trackwork going on, and the entire line was closed. We stayed here for four days in a very pretty town with half-timbered houses and a brewery where they tap homemade beer and have delicious food. We enjoyed sitting in the courtyard. Excellent.

A fantastic site with spacious pitches. 12 pitches can be reserved in advance and 12 can be accessed freely using a parking meter. Clean restrooms and showers in the clubhouse, for which you receive a code. For €13, there's nothing to complain about here 👌🤗

Information

Camper place near the center - 16 of the 24 places have electricity connection - historic city - center 500m.
